Switch Types Decoded: Speed Isn’t Just Sound
I bought my first mechanical keyboard thinking “clicky = fast.”
Turns out I was wrong.
Linear switches register fastest (but) only if their actuation is consistent. I measured mine. Gateron Yellow had a standard deviation of 0.3mm.
Kailh Box Jade? 0.7mm. That extra 0.4mm adds up in rapid double-taps.
Tactile switches like TTC Gold feel precise (until) factory lube dries unevenly. Then you get ghost presses. I lost two ranked MOBA matches because of it.
Optical switches skip the physical contact entirely. No debounce lag. No spring fatigue.
They just fire.
For FPS? Go optical or Gateron Yellow. For rhythm games?
TTC Gold (but) only if you re-lube them yourself. For MOBA? Kailh Box Jade if you’re okay with higher force and finger burn after 75 minutes.
Firmware-upgradable switches? Rare. But they matter.
You can tweak debounce timing after you buy. Not guess at it before.

Beyond Switches: What Actually Cuts Latency in Half

Polling rate is a lie. It’s the headline number everyone quotes. But it’s just one stop on the signal path.
The USB controller matters more. Cheap ones add 1.5ms right off the bat. I’ve tested boards with identical switches and wildly different latency (just) from swapping controllers.
Onboard buffering? Key. If the keyboard can’t hold your keystrokes while waiting for the host, you get ghosting or dropped inputs.
Not just N-key rollover (how) it handles simultaneous presses under load.
2.4GHz wireless isn’t slower than wired. If it’s done right. Top-tier models like the Drop Alt Wireless hit sub-2ms end-to-end.
Budget ones hover at 4. 7ms. That’s not “good enough.” That’s noticeable in a twitch fight.
PCB design isn’t just about routing traces. Hot-swappable sockets with gold-plated contacts hold resistance stable for 2+ years. Cheap tin sockets oxidize.
You feel it after six months.
Firmware runs the show. Adaptive polling? Changing debounce?
Dedicated gaming microcontrollers (not) shared MCUs doing lighting + input + USB all at once.

Ergonomics That Boost Accuracy. Not Just Comfort
I stopped caring about wrist rests years ago. They feel nice. They do nothing for accuracy.
Real ergonomics change how your fingers move. Not how your wrists rest.
That 2024 study tracked typing errors across 90-minute sessions on four keyboard geometries: flat, split, tented, and ortho. Tented and ortho layouts cut keypress errors by 22% compared to flat boards. (Spoiler: flat keyboards are basically ergonomic theater.)
Lower-profile keys matter more than you think. DSA caps reduce lateral finger travel versus SA. Motion-capture data shows up to 30% fewer micro-adjustments per session.
Fewer tiny corrections means fewer mistakes.
Tenting isn’t magic. It’s math. 12°. 18° is the sweet spot. Less than that?
No benefit. More? You strain your shoulders.
Negative tilt at 5°. 7° keeps your forearms neutral. Anything steeper forces wrist extension.
Some “ergonomic” keyboards wobble. Or have inconsistent actuation. That’s worse than a straight board.
Stability beats gimmicks every time.
